Quick intro to ParityPeek, our hotel rate-parity checker. It scrapes partner rates nightly, flags mismatches over 2%, and files tickets automatically. Releases go out Tuesdays; just make sure the scraper configs are frozen 24 hours prior. Cut instructions, rollback steps, and the freeze calendar are all kept on the internal page below.

operations page: https://jenkins.zemvarcloud.local/job/merge_requests/repo/build/73930b4b30f0a8ed

Welcome to the Pellwood notifications team. Our fan-out service pushes events to millions of devices, so backpressure matters: when downstream queues exceed the high-water mark, the dispatcher sheds low-priority traffic and emits a throttle metric you can watch on the Brinley dashboard. Your first task is to run the backpressure simulator locally against staging. The simulator authenticates to the staging dispatcher as a service client, using the key provided below.

gateway credential: vxb4-QTMv

## Deployment

Thumbforge runs as a standalone worker pool that consumes render jobs from the Quillbrook message bus. Plugins are loaded from the plugins directory at startup; hot reload is not supported. Scale workers horizontally — each claims jobs independently and writes output to the shared object store. On boot, each worker reads the following configuration values.

config for bawep-faduf:
OLIATH_HOST=oliath.qorvellabs.internal
OLIATH_PORT=9000